After 44 days, finally made a definite turn East ... on US 26 in Redmond, OR. Another great ride this time up in the mountains of Oregon on US 26 . The pictures don't do it justice because the sun was facing us, duh, out of the east, all morning. The roads were great and we easily cruised at 55. Again we lucked out and there wasn't a lot of traffic. Stayed comfortable til we got on I-84 and headed south towards Idaho when the temps climbed to 104. The ol' wet bandana around the neck keeps the brain cool. Fella by the name of Steve working the front desk at the Super 8 in Bend was born In Annapolis. His dad was a Naval Officer teaching at the Academy. He attended the Coast Guard Academy while I was stationed there ... in New London, CT. He rides a Ural. It's a Russian bike that comes stock with sidecar. I looked at these at the Washington bike show. They are great back-to-the-basics bikes that you can work on yourself. Plus he says it's good in the snow.
